Soter Vineyards

Mineral Springs Ranch Pinot Noir 2012

Lovely nose of cherry, strawberry and a hint of rose petals. Well structured red and black fruit with a cola backbone on the palate. Moderate plus and consistent acid from start to long finish. This is a big but disciplined Pinot that falls somewhere between a California and Burgundy style. — 9 years ago

Aubert

UV-SL Vineyard Chardonnay 2014

14’ Aubert UV-SL. Wine Nerd Herd virtual tasting. Been fortunate enough to have this wine a dozen times. Unlike the 2013 I had last week, this has seen better days. Still delicious & won’t turn down a glass/bottle. It certainly will drink for many years to come. The 2013 has got another 5/8 years in it..  I wouldn’t hesitate to purchase a case of the 13.
Makes points of subtlety & finesse, with touches of cream, smoky oak, apple & pear, light acidity ,falls short towards the end of the glass. Ending with a poached pear & oaky finish.
